Abstract
With the easy availability of computed tomography scanning, the majority of large extradural hematomas are identified and evacuated early. Hence, a large chronic extradural hematoma (CEDH) is rarely encountered in current clinical practice. The authors describe an interesting case of a large bifrontal CEDH associated with superior sagittal sinus injury in a 32-year-old man. We also present a review of 43 cases available in the literature, and discuss various concepts of classification of CEDHs and their management. [ABSTRACT FROM AUTHOR]
